About Keren Skalsky

Keren Skalsky is a scholar working on Nephrology, Cardiology and Cardiovascular Medicine and Transplantation, having authored 20 papers that have together received 494 indexed citations. Recurring topics across this work include Acute Kidney Injury Research (5 papers), Cardiac Valve Diseases and Treatments (4 papers) and Cardiac Imaging and Diagnostics (3 papers). The work is most often cited by research in Small Animals (170 citations), Critical Care and Intensive Care Medicine (51 citations) and Epidemiology (284 citations). Keren Skalsky has collaborated with scholars based in Israel, United States and Denmark. Frequent co-authors include Leonard Leibovici, Mical Paul, Dafna Yahav, Jihad Bishara, Silvio Pitlik, Tomer Avni, Elena Carrara, Anat Stern, Anat Gafter‐Gvili and Eli Muchtar. Their work appears in journals such as Cochrane Database of Systematic Reviews, The American Journal of Cardiology and European Journal of Cancer.
